Bigger Brains and Longer Thumbs: The Surprising Connection in Primates

TL;DR

Recent research indicates a surprising link between thumb length and brain size in primates. Longer thumbs might mean bigger brains, suggesting a deep connection between manual dexterity and cognitive evolution.

This correlation hints at how our ancestors evolved, balancing tool use and brain development. The findings challenge our understanding of evolution, pushing the boundaries of what we thought we knew about primate intelligence.

Studies show that this physical trait could be a marker for cognitive abilities, offering insights into how dexterity and brain size have evolved together.

According to the study, primates with longer thumbs not only have a better grip but also exhibit larger brain sizes. This raises the question: did our ancestors evolve to have dexterous hands to develop their brainpower? Or did brain growth lead to the need for more dexterous digits? It’s a chicken-and-egg scenario that leaves us pondering the intricate dance of evolution.
